The hexadecimal color code #C1BBBA corresponds to the code RGB( 193, 187, 186 ). It's a shade of Gray. This color is a combination of red (at 0,76 level), green (at 0,73 level) and blue (at 0,73 level). Its brightness is 74% and its saturation is 5%. It is composed of red at 34%, green at 33% and blue at 32%.
